2017 Bundeschampionate Qualifier

At the 2017 Grafschafter Horse Sport Festival in Haftenkamp, Germany, one Bundeschampionate qualification class was being held for 6-year old dressage horses. On Friday 19 May 2017 eighteen horses competed in the M-level dressage horse test to earn a ticket to the Bundeschampionate in Warendorf in September.

Frederic Wandres and Gestut Ammerland's Oldenburg stallion Fior (by Furstenball x Sandro Hit) reigned sumpreme with an 8.4 total score, staying far ahead of all competition. Judges Lammers, Scheermann, Straube-Thiel and Egbers rewarded the dark bay stallion with 8 for walk, 9 for trot, 8.5 for canter, 8 for submission and 8.5 for general impression.

Young Rider Alexa Westendarp  steered her father's Hanoverian mare Four Seasons (by Furstenball x Fidertanz) to a second place with 8.1. The black mare got 8 for walk, 9 for trot, 7 for canter, 8.5 for submission and 8 for general impression.

Four combinations tied in third place with 8.0: Claudia Ruscher and her father's Holsteiner stallion Champagner (by Catoo x Aljano) got 7.5 for walk, 8 for trot, 9 for canter, 7.5 for submission and 8 for general impression. Melanie Tewes and Dressage Performance Centre Lodbergen's Oldenburg gelding Faradai (by Furstenball x Lanciano) earned 7.5 for walk, 8.5 for trot, 8 for canter, submission and general impression. Tessa Frank and Helmut von Fircks' Hanoverian stallion First Choice (by Fidertanz x De Niro) got 8 for walk, 8.5 for trot, 7.5 for canter and submission and 8.5 for general impression. Frederic Wandres and Hof Kasselmann's Furstenfee (by Furstenball x Donnerhall) scored 8 for walk, 8.5 for trot, 7.5 for canter and submission and 8.5 for general impression.
